which of the following is a primary function of the active site of an enzyme? it binds allosteric regulators of the enzyme. it binds noncompetitive inhibitors of the enzyme. it is activated by the presence of the end product of the metabolic pathway in which the enzyme is involved. it catalyzes the reaction associated with the enzyme.
The active - site of an enzyme is the region where the substrate binds and the chemical reaction is catalyzed. Allosteric regulators bind to allosteric sites, non - competitive inhibitors bind to sites other than the active site, and end - product activation is related to allosteric regulation, not the primary function of the active site.
